Omicron toll in India reaches 25, two new cases in Gujarat

Gandhinagar, Dec.10: After one South African returnee tested positive for Covid with the new version on December 4, two other people in Gujarat have tested positive for the Omicron Covid variant. With this, India’s overall number of Omicron cases is now 25.

A traveller from Zimbabwe to Gujarat’s Jamnagar tested positive for the Omicron variant of coronavirus on December 4. The new cases have been detected among his contacts.

The returnee from South Africa is completely vaccinated. At least ten people have been quarantined and tested after coming into touch with him.

According to government sources, top officials from the Health Ministry notified a parliamentary panel on Thursday that there are 23 cases of the Omicron type of Covid-19, and authorities are actively watching the issue.

The health officials presented a comprehensive presentation on the Omicron variant and other COVID-19-related issues.

On the matter of ‘Challenges posed by Omicron version of Covid-19,’ the Health Secretary, ICMR Director General, and other key officials from the ministry spoke before the Parliamentary Standing Committee on Health, chaired by Ram Gopal Yadav.

Officials said that if a third dosage of the Covid-19 vaccination is needed, it can be given after nine months following the second dose, according to the sources.
